Как очистить DNS в Windows 10

Система доменных имен (DNS) преобразует имена веб-сайтов в IP-адреса (числовой/буквенно-цифровой формат), чтобы веб-сайт загружался для пользователей.

Проще говоря, DNS отвечает за загрузку веб-сайтов на ваш компьютер. Если веб-сайты не загружаются, очистка кеша преобразователя DNS может вернуть веб-сайты.

Эта статья для вас, если у вас есть веб-сайт, который не загружается в вашем браузере, и вам необходимо очистить записи DNS.

Что означает сброс DNS?

Очистка кеша DNS относится к процессу удаления IP-адресов или кеша преобразователя DNS интернет-соединения для устранения проблем, связанных с цифровой безопасностью и сетевым подключением. Существующий DNS-адрес удаляется и настраивается на автоматический поиск DNS- или IP-адреса. Вы можете выполнить эту задачу вручную или без каких-либо действий.

Несмотря на то, что кеш DNS продолжает очищаться сам по себе из-за функции, известной как время жизни (TTL). Одна конкретная запись DNS действительна в течение всего срока службы. По истечении времени он автоматически сбрасывается.

Как правило, перезагрузка маршрутизатора и использование команды ipconfig /flushdns в командной строке Windows 10 могут помочь вам решить эту проблему.

Почему вы должны очищать кеш DNS Resolver?

Ниже приведены причины, по которым вам необходимо вручную очищать локальный кеш DNS, не дожидаясь истечения срока жизни:

  1. Ошибки 404 являются распространенными симптомами плохого DNS. Если вы видите ошибку 404 или старую версию веб-сайта, который вы пытаетесь загрузить.
  2. Сайт может не загружаться.

Вы можете очистить файлы cookie, историю и настройки браузера, чтобы увидеть, загружается ли веб-сайт. Если это не так, очистка DNS — ваше решение.

  1. Изменение вашего DNS-адреса может защитить вашу конфиденциальность в Интернете. Это может защитить вас от сайтов, которые собирают вашу информацию.
  2. Вы можете очистить кеш DNS, чтобы злоумышленники не получили доступ к вашей информации и не перенаправили вас на нерелевантные сайты домена.

Очистка кэша DNS

3 способа очистки кэша DNS в Windows 10

Есть три способа очистить кеш DNS в Windows 10.

1. Команда Windows

  1. Нажмите клавиши Windows плюс R, чтобы запустить утилиту Windows Run.
  2. В поле «Открыть» введите следующую команду:

ipconfig /flushdns

  1. Нажмите клавишу Enter, чтобы очистить адрес DNS-сервера.

Вы увидите сообщение «Конфигурация IP-адреса Windows успешно очистила кеш преобразователя DNS» после завершения процесса, и кеш DNS будет изменен.

2. Windows PowerShell

  1. Щелкните правой кнопкой мыши кнопку «Пуск» или нажмите клавишу Windows + X, чтобы открыть меню быстрой ссылки.
  2. Выберите Windows PowerShell (администратор). Кроме того, вы можете найти PowerShell и запустить его от имени администратора.
  3. Введите в интерфейсе следующую команду:

Clear-DnsClientCache

  1. Нажмите клавишу Enter, чтобы запустить эту команду.

3. Командная строка

  1. Нажмите на строку поиска, введите cmd, и вы сможете увидеть окно командной строки и соответствующие параметры. Команду cmd также можно использовать в инструменте «Выполнить», чтобы открыть командную строку.
  2. Выберите «Запуск от имени администратора» в результатах поиска.
  3. Введите ipconfig /flushdns в окне командной строки и нажмите Enter.

Как очистить DNS Windows 7

Более ранняя версия Windows 7 также имеет аналогичный способ очистки кэша DNS на вашем компьютере. Он также использует инструмент командной строки.

Вот шаги, чтобы очистить кеш DNS, если вы используете Windows 7:

  1. Нажмите кнопку «Пуск» в левом нижнем углу экрана.
  2. Выберите опцию «Все программы» и выберите «Стандартные».
  3. Найдите инструмент командной строки, щелкните его правой кнопкой мыши и выберите «Запуск от имени администратора».
  4. Выберите «Да» в появившемся окне с вопросом, хотите ли вы разрешить командной строке вносить изменения в ваш компьютер. Если вы не являетесь системным администратором, вам потребуется их помощь для выполнения этой операции.
  5. Введите команду ipconfig /flushdns и нажмите Enter, чтобы очистить кеш DNS.

После завершения вы увидите сообщение о том, что кеш DNS Resolver успешно очищен.

Как очистить DNS Windows XP и Vista

Процесс очистки кэша DNS в Windows XP и Vista очень похож на тот же процесс в Windows 7.

Вот ваши шаги, чтобы очистить кеш DNS в Windows XP и Vista:

  1. Нажмите клавишу Windows или нажмите кнопку «Пуск», чтобы открыть меню «Пуск».
  2. Откройте «Все программы» и выберите «Стандартные».
  3. Отсюда откройте инструмент командной строки.
  4. Введите ipconfig /flushdns и нажмите Enter в окне командной строки.
  5. Вы можете получить сообщение «Действие требует повышения прав». В этом случае администратор должен выполнить процедуру, описанную выше.

Как очистить DNS Mac OS X

Каждая версия Mac OS на вашем Mac имеет один и тот же метод изменения кеша преобразователя DNS. Но команда терминала может быть другой.

Вот шаги и команды для очистки Mac DNS:

  1. Нажмите клавиши Option + Command + Space на клавиатуре, чтобы открыть инструмент Finder.
  2. Выберите «Приложения» и найдите папку «Утилиты».
  3. Откройте его и запустите приложение «Терминал». Как вариант, можно запустить лаунчер и найти в нем Терминал.
  4. В Терминале введите следующие команды в зависимости от версии ПО:
    1. Версия 10.4: lookupd -flushcache
    2. Версия 10.5 – 10.6: sudo dscacheutil -flushcache
    3. Версия 10.7 – 10.9: sudo killall -HUP mDNSResponder
    4. Версия 10.10: sudo discoveryutil mdnsflushcache
    5. Версия 10.11 – 10.14: sudo killall -HUP mDNSResponder
  5. Введите пароль и нажмите Enter.
  6. Подтверждающее сообщение сообщит вам, когда адрес DNS-сервера будет очищен.

Как очистить DNS Google Chrome

Браузер Google Chrome имеет собственный кеш DNS. Это можно изменить через Chrome на MacOC или Windows 10, и шаги те же.

Вот ваши шаги, чтобы очистить кеш браузера Chrome:

  1. Запустите Chrome и введите в адресной строке вверху следующее:

chrome://net-internals/#dns

  1. Нажмите кнопку «Очистить кэш хоста», чтобы очистить DNS-сервер.

Как очистить DNS Linux

ОС Linux не получает адрес DNS по умолчанию . У пользователей Linux есть два варианта — очистить кеш DNS или перезапустить системную службу Linux.

Вот что вам нужно сделать:

  1. Запустите инструмент «Терминал», нажав Ctrl + Alt + T на клавиатуре.
  2. Введите следующие команды, в зависимости от службы Linux, запущенной в вашей системе:
    1. Dnsmasq: sudo /etc/init.d/dnsmasq перезапустить
    2. NCSD: sudo /etc/init.d/nscd перезапустить
    3. BIND: здесь есть несколько команд
      1. sudo /etc/init.d/названный перезапуск
      2. sudo rndc-exec
      3. sudo rndc перезапустить

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*